HamburgerMenu
hirist

Job Description

Description :

Role Overview :

We are seeking an experienced Azure DevOps Engineer to design, implement, and manage CI/CD pipelines, cloud infrastructure, and containerized platforms on Microsoft Azure. The ideal candidate will have strong hands-on experience with Azure DevOps Services, AKS, and Infrastructure as Code, and will play a key role in enabling reliable, secure, and scalable cloud-native solutions.

Key Responsibilities :

- Design, build, and maintain CI/CD pipelines using Azure DevOps Pipelines, enabling automated build, test, and deployment workflows across environments.

- Actively use Azure DevOps Boards and Repos to support Agile delivery, version control, and traceability across development teams.

- Deploy, manage, and optimize Azure Kubernetes Service (AKS) clusters, including workload orchestration, scaling, upgrades, and troubleshooting.

- Implement Infrastructure as Code (IaC) using Terraform, ensuring repeatable, secure, and scalable Azure resource provisioning.

- Develop and maintain automation scripts using PowerShell and YAML, supporting pipeline automation, configuration management, and operational tasks.

- Configure and manage Azure networking components, including VNets, subnets, NSGs, load balancers, and private endpoints, ensuring secure connectivity.

- Implement Azure security and identity controls, leveraging Azure AD, RBAC, managed identities, and best practices for access management.

- Perform Linux system administration tasks for AKS worker nodes, including monitoring, patching, performance tuning, and issue resolution.

- Collaborate closely with development, QA, security, and cloud architecture teams to support DevOps best practices and continuous improvement.

- Troubleshoot production issues, perform root cause analysis, and contribute to system reliability and uptime.

Required Skills & Experience :

- Strong hands-on experience with Azure DevOps Services, including Pipelines for CI/CD, Boards for Agile planning, and Repos for source control management.

- Deep expertise in AKS and Kubernetes, with practical experience in container orchestration, deployments, scaling, and cluster operations.

- Proven experience implementing Terraform for Azure infrastructure provisioning and lifecycle management.

- Proficiency in PowerShell and YAML scripting for automation, pipeline configuration, and operational workflows.

- Solid understanding of Azure networking, security, and identity management, including VNets, NSGs, Azure AD, RBAC, and secure access patterns.

- Hands-on experience with Linux administration, particularly in managing and supporting AKS node environments.

- Strong troubleshooting, problem-solving, and communication skills.

- Experience working in Agile/DevOps environments with cross-functional teams.

Nice to Have :

- Experience with monitoring and logging tools (Azure Monitor, Log Analytics, Prometheus, Grafana).

- Exposure to GitOps practices or tools such as Argo CD or Flux.

- Azure certifications (AZ-104, AZ-400) are a plus.


info-icon

Did you find something suspicious?

Similar jobs that you might be interested in